Field and CAD Technician - Grand Rapids, MI

Wiss, Janney, Elstner Associates, Inc. (WJE) is seeking an exceptional Field and CAD Technician to join our team in Grand Rapids, Michigan.

WJE solves some of the most interesting challenges in the built world, and as a Field and CAD Technician you will have the opportunity to learn from and grow alongside industry-leading experts. A Technician plays a key role in helping project teams deliver high quality field assessments, execute field-performed testing, and create accurate construction documents, efficiently and within budget, all while meeting the demands of a fast-paced work environment.

Responsibilities:
  • Travel to project work sites to provide support in the field, including data retrieval and verification, on-site field-performed testing of built assemblies, and participating in field assessments and investigations with project staff
  • Produce high-quality, accurate construction documents for the repair and rehabilitation of various building and infrastructure systems, including structural, facades and cladding, and roofing and waterproofing systems
  • Develop preliminary and final drawings using the information derived from existing construction documents, backgrounds and/or rough layouts, and with assistance from the project team through field notes, sketches, or verbal instructions
  • Provide input and assist with updating and maintaining local and company-wide CAD standards and detail library
  • Assist project staff with the preparation of high-quality written deliverables, such as site visit reports and investigative assessments. Maintain high levels of efficiency and productivity to consistently deliver project on schedule and within budget

Requirements:
  • Two or more years of relevant construction experience and CAD expertise, with demonstrated proficiency using Autodesk’s AutoCAD Architecture software required
  • Associate's degree in construction technology, drafting technology, or computer-aided design and drafting (Certification with equivalent experience will be considered in place of a degree)
  • Preferably skilled with hands, experienced with carpentry and power tools, ability to adapt and construct testing chambers with assistance from project staff. Ability to use progressive design software such as Autodesk Revit Architecture and Google SketchUp is preferred, with the desire and willingness to achieve proficiency
  • Current knowledge of industry design and drafting standards
  • Knowledgeable/Skilled with ancillary software such as Adobe Acrobat, Photoshop, and Bluebeam
